Toxic goods storage and preservation of1 ScopeThis standard specifies the terms and definitions toxic storage and preservation of goods, storage conditions, warehousing inspection, stacking, conservation technology, Safe operation, a library and emergency response requirements. This standard applies to conserve storage 3.1 Definitions goods.2 Normative referencesThe following documents for the application of this document is essential. For dated references, only the dated version suitable for use herein Member. For undated references, the latest edition (including any amendments) applies to this document. GB 6944-2012 Classification and code of dangerous goods GB 15258 rules for preparation of chemical safety labels3 Terms and DefinitionsThe following terms and definitions apply to this document. 3.1 Toxic goods toxicgoods Toxic Goods After ingestion, inhalation or contact with the skin may cause death or serious injury or damage to human health substances. [GB 6944-2012, Dangerous Goods Classification 4.7.2.1.1]4 storage conditions4.1 Treasury 4.1.1 Treasury dry and ventilated. Mechanical ventilation should be safety and detoxification treatment measures. 4.1.2 Treasury fire resistance rating of not less than two. 4.2 Security 4.2.1 Storage should be away from residential areas and water sources. 4.2.2 Goods avoid direct sunlight exposure, away from heat, power, fire, in the library (area) with fixed and convenient location with toxic Suppliers Goods Properties to match the fire equipment, alarm devices and first aid kit. 4.2.3 Different types of poisonous goods, depending on the degree of danger and the different fire fighting methods should be stored separately, the toxic nature of the balance of goods Should not coexist with the library (see Appendix A). 4.2.4 highly toxic product should be used for special storage or storage in a single space between each other, and install anti-theft alarm and monitoring systems, installed double doors Lock, the implementation of double transceiver Double custody system. 4.3 Environment Reservoir coffers and keep clean. Scattered on toxic goods should be in accordance with the method of its safety data sheet at the proper collection Weed management, timely removal of the reservoir area. Used clothes, gloves and other items should be placed in a safe place outside the library, safekeeping and timely manner. more When changing store poisonous varieties of goods, to the Treasury cleaned. 4.4 Temperature and humidity Treasury temperature should not exceed 35 ℃. Toxic volatile commodity, warehouse temperature should be controlled below 32 ℃, relative humidity should 85% or less. For deliquescent toxic goods, the Treasury should be controlled relative humidity below 80%.5 warehousing inspection5.1 Principles 5.1.1 The storage of goods should be accompanied by quality certificate and safety data sheets. Chinese imports should also have safety data sheet or other instructions. 5.1.2 The storage of goods should be separately according to the type of storage toxic goods, take the isolation, separated, isolated storage. 5.1.3 The quality of the goods shall comply with the relevant product standard, the test is responsible for the inventory. 5.1.4 safekeeping party goods appearance, both inside and outside signs, containers and packaging, gaskets, etc. sensory testing. 5.1.5 Each product packaging should be open for acceptance, inspection found the problem to expand the proportion of packaging recovery after inspection and marking. 5.1.6 Acceptance shall be carried out in a safe location outside the warehouse. 5.2 Acceptance of the project 5.2.1 Packaging 5.2.1.1 package labels shall comply with the provisions of GB 15258. 5.2.1.2 packaging should be intact, no moisture, pollution. 5.2.2 Quality 5.2.2.1 Goods characters, colors, etc. shall comply with the relevant product standards. 5.2.2.2 Liquid Colour change, no precipitation, no impurities. 5.2.2.3 The solid product no color, no lumps, no deliquescence, no melting phenomenon. 5.2.3 Acceptance 5.2.3.1 should be performed double review system. 5.2.3.2 does not comply with the provisions of 5.1 should not be put in storage of goods, should be staging a safe place, inform the storing party, be dealt with separately. 5.2.3.3 Eligible receipt of goods warehousing, complete inspection records, inventory turn square. 5.2.3.4 When the packaging leaking, replace the package before storage, packaging renovations required in special places. Toxic spill on the ground to clear goods Clean sweep, centralized storage, unified handling.6 Stacker6.1 Principles Stacking goods to meet the safe, convenient principle, easy stacking, inspection and fire fighting, thatch pad material should be dedicated. 6.2 Information 6.2.1 cargo stack should be moisture-proof facilities, pile bottom from the ground distance not less than 15cm. 6.2.2 The cargo stack should be solid, clean, airy, stack height does not exceed 3m. 6.3 spacing It should be kept. a) the main channel ≥180cm; b) branched channels ≥80cm; c) wall distance ≥30cm; d) column spacing ≥10cm; e) stack from ≥10cm; f) from the top ≥50cm.7 Maintenance Technology7.1 Temperature and humidity management 7.1.1 Temperature and Humidity disposed within the table, observation time record. 7.1.2 library strict control of temperature and humidity, to keep within the desired range. 7.2 Check 7.2.1 Security 7.2.1.1 Reservoir daily inspection, check whether the clean-up and other combustible cargo pile is solid, without exception. 7.2.1.2 In case of special weather should be checked for damage merchandise. 7.2.1.3 Periodic inspection library facilities, fire equipment, protective equipment is complete and effective. 7.2.2 Quality 7.2.2.1 According to the nature of goods, regular quality checks, checks each commodity 1 ~ 2. 7.2.2.2 Check the packaging, sealing gasket without damage, appearance and quality of goods or without changes. 7.2.3 Processing 7.2.3.1 itemized record inspection results, and mark. 7.2.3.2 make a record of the problems found, notify the storing party to take measures to prevent and treat. 7.2.3.3 commodity in question should be adjusted to fill a single reminder, reported inventory side, and settling problems.8 safe operation8.1 Workers should hold their posts toxic product conservation credentials. 8.2 workers should wear gloves and appropriate masks or protective masks, protective clothing. 8.3 job should not diet, not a hand to wipe your mouth, face, eyes. Every time a job is completed, should be promptly with soap (or special detergent) wash face Ministry hands, gargle with water, protective equipment should be cleaned, centralized storage. 8.4 Operation gently, not collision, inversion, packaging to prevent breakage, leak or commodity.9 LibraryWe should adhere to the principle of FIFO. 10 Emergency Treatment See Appendix B. 10.1 fire. 10.2 Poisoning method, see Appendix C, and should be sent to hospital for treatment.Appendix A(Normative) Dangerous Goods chemical properties coexist netting table Table A.1 shows the performance of hazardous goods coexist netting note. Category Name extinguishing agents are prohibited Remark Inorganic Toxic Harmfulness commodity Arsenate, arsenite water Arsenate, arsenic and its compounds, arsenic trioxide, arsenic acid, brine, sand Selenite, selenious anhydride, selenium and its compounds in water, sand Selenium powder, sand, water, powder Mercuric chloride water, sand Chloride, cyanide melt, quenching salt, sand acid foam Hydrocyanic acid solution of carbon dioxide, dry powder, foam organic Toxic Harmfulness commodity Enemy dead on, chloropicrin, isopropyl fluorophosphate, 1240 emulsions, 3911,1440 Sand, water Tetraethyl lead dry sand, foam Strychnos alkaline Dimethyl sulfate dry sand, foam, carbon dioxide, water spray 1605 emulsion, the emulsion 1059 water and sand acid foam Inorganic poisonous Harmfulness commodity Sodium fluoride, fluorides, fluorosilicates, lead oxide, barium oxide, Mercury and mercury compounds, tellurium and its compounds, carbonate, beryllium, beryllium and Its compound Silica, water organic poisonous Harmfulness commodity Cyanide in methylene chloride, carbon dioxide, other compounds containing cyanide, water spray, Silica Benzene Chlorides (polychlorinated thereof) sand, foam, carbon dioxide, water spray Acid ester foam, water, carbon dioxide Paraffin (olefin) of bromides, other aldehydes, alcohols, ketones, esters, such as benzene, Bromide Foam, sand Barium salts of various organic compounds, nitrobenzene chlorine (bromine) methane sand, foam, water spray Organic arsenic, oxalic acid, oxalates sand, water, foam, carbon dioxide Oxalates, sulfates, phosphates foam, water, carbon dioxide Amine compounds of various compounds, aniline, phenylenediamine hydrochloride (O-, m-, p-) Sand, foam, water spray Diamino toluene, ethyl naphthylamine, di-nitrodiphenylamine, and the corpus of benzene Compounds, phenol compounds, nitro phenol sodium salt, a nitro group Chloride, phenol, benzene Sand, foam, water spray, carbon dioxide Table B.1 (continued) Category Name extinguishing agents are prohibited Remark organic poisonous Harmfulness commodity Furfural, nitro naphthalene foam, carbon dioxide, water spray, sand Original powder DDT, toxaphene original powder, 666 original powder foam, sand Chlordane, trichlorfon, Marathon, aerosols, clofibrate, phenobarbital Salt, Ami tall and its sodium salt, Saili bulk raw powder, 1 naphthonitriles, charcoal Gangrene tooth cell vaccine, the birds come because, crude anthracene, emetine and its salts, bitter apricot Jen acid, and sodium pentobarbital Water, sand, foamAppendix C(Informative) Poisoning first aid C.1 respiratory tract (inhalation) poisoning Toxic vapors, fumes, dust is inhaled respiratory departments, the occurrence of poisoning, mostly itchy throat, cough, runny nose, tightness, dizziness, head Pain and so on. After the discovery of the above, poisoning should immediately leave the scene to fresh air repose. Dyspnea, could make it into oxygen or Artificial respiration. Before performing artificial respiration should be opened his jacket, but not allow it to stop before the cold, artificial respiration to restore normal breathing after, and Be treated immediately. No poison alertness greater risk, such as methyl bromide, the operation should be determined before the gas concentration in the air, with sponsorship Physical safety. C.2 digestive tract (oral) toxicity Poisoning finger to stimulate the throat, or injection of 1% apomorphine 0.5mL to induce vomiting or with Angelica or three, rhubarb one or two, raw licorice Five money, boiled served with purgative, such as the Department of one thousand and fifty-nine, one thousand six hundred and five commodities and other oil-soluble toxic poisoning, disabled castor oil, liquid paraffin oil Quality purgative. Poisoning vomiting should stay in bed to keep the body temperature, can drink hot tea. C.3 skin (contact) poisoning Skin (contact) poisoning, wash immediately with plenty of water, then wash with soap and water, apply a layer of zinc oxide cream or boric acid to ensure a soft green Skin care, severe cases should be sent to hospital for treatment.
